A Comprehensive Guide to Snowflake Cloning
In the ever-evolving landscape of data management, databases play a crucial role in storing
and organizing vast amounts of information. With the increasing complexity and scale of
modern applications, having a flexible and efficient database structure is essential for
smooth operations. One such innovative approach that has gained traction in recent years is
snowflake cloning, a technique that enables organizations to optimize their database
performance by creating virtual copies or snapshots of specific tables within a larger
database.
Traditionally, when it comes to analyzing large datasets or running complex queries,
developers often face challenges due to the immense processing power required. Copying
an entire database or table for analysis purposes can be time-consuming and
resource-intensive. This is where snowflake cloning steps in as a game-changer.
What is Snowflake?
Snowflake is a cloud-based data warehousing platform that provides a fully managed and
scalable solution for storing, analyzing, and processing large amounts of structured and
semi-structured data. It is designed to handle data-intensive workloads and offers features
such as high concurrency, automatic scaling, and native support for SQL queries.
Snowflake's architecture separates storage and compute, allowing organizations to scale
their compute resources independently based on their needs. It is known for its ease of use,
performance, and the ability to handle complex data analytics tasks.
Become a Snowflake Certified professional by learning this HKR Snowflake Training !
Database Cloning:
Database cloning refers to the process of creating an exact replica or copy of a database.
This copy contains the same data and structure as the original database but exists
independently. Cloning a database is typically done for various purposes such as testing,
development, reporting, analysis, or creating backups.
Snowflake Clones and its uses:
In the context of Snowflake, "clones" refer to an advanced feature of the Snowflake data
warehousing platform. Snowflake allows users to create clones of their databases or specific
tables within a database. A clone is a lightweight, efficient, and virtually instantaneous copy
of the original database or table.
Snowflake clones are useful for several reasons:
a. Testing and Development: Clones provide a safe and isolated environment for testing new
code, making changes, and experimenting without affecting the production data. Developers
can create clones to test queries, perform data transformations, or develop new features.
Want to know more about Snowflake,visit here Snowflake Tutorial !
b. Performance Optimization: Clones can be used to improve the performance of
resource-intensive workloads. By creating clones, different teams or users can work
independently without impacting each other's performance. It allows for parallel processing
and enables efficient resource allocation.
c. Data Analysis: Clones are beneficial for performing data analysis and running complex
queries without affecting the production database. Analysts can create clones to explore the
data, generate insights, and create reports without impacting the live system.
d. Cost Control: Snowflake's cloning feature is built on its unique architecture, where storage
and compute are decoupled. Clones utilize the same underlying storage as the original
database but consume compute resources independently. This allows organizations to
optimize costs by scaling compute resources for specific tasks without duplicating storage.
Top 30 frequently asked Snowflake Interview Questions !
Conclusion:
In conclusion, snowflake cloning is a powerful feature in Snowflake's database that allows for
efficient and cost-effective data replication. By creating a clone of a table or an entire
database, users can easily make changes or perform analysis without affecting the original
data. The ability to clone tables also enables parallel processing, speeding up queries and
improving overall performance. Additionally, with the flexibility to create clones on-demand,
organizations can quickly scale their data operations as needed. As businesses continue to
generate and analyze large volumes of data, snowflake cloning offers a valuable solution for
managing and manipulating data efficiently. Embracing this feature will undoubtedly enhance
productivity and drive better insights for organizations of all sizes. So why wait? Start
leveraging snowflake cloning in your data operations today!
If you want to know more about snowflake cloning, visit this blog Snowflake Cloning !

More Related Content

PDF
Best-Practices-for-Using-Tableau-With-Snowflake.pdf
PPTX
10 Reasons Snowflake Is Great for Analytics
PDF
snowpro-core.pdf dumps 2025 latest pdf .
DOC
snowflake-course-training-in-hyderabad.DOC
PDF
oracle-adw-melts snowflake-report.pdf
PPTX
The Snowflake course training in Hyderabad
PPTX
The Snowflake training in Hyderabad (3zenx)
PDF
Migration to Oracle 12c Made Easy Using Replication Technology
Best-Practices-for-Using-Tableau-With-Snowflake.pdf
10 Reasons Snowflake Is Great for Analytics
snowpro-core.pdf dumps 2025 latest pdf .
snowflake-course-training-in-hyderabad.DOC
oracle-adw-melts snowflake-report.pdf
The Snowflake course training in Hyderabad
The Snowflake training in Hyderabad (3zenx)
Migration to Oracle 12c Made Easy Using Replication Technology

Similar to Snowflake Cloning.pdf (20)

PDF
iovlabs.pdf
DOCX
What Is a Data Lakehouse? Benefits, Features & Platforms
DOCX
Snowflake Technology.docx
PDF
Things You Should Know About Snowflake Warehouses
PDF
Introduction to Snowflake & Cloud Data Warehousing | Best Snowflake Online Tr...
PDF
SnowPro Core Study Guide for certification.pdf
PDF
Data Engineering Interview Questions & Answers Warehouses & Lakehouses (Snowf...
PPTX
Snowflake Training in Hyderabad Snowflake Training - Enroll Now.pptx
PDF
Snowflake_Cheat_Sheet_Snowflake_Cheat_Sheet
PPTX
Why Snowflake is important and what is Snowflake
PDF
Azure Data Factory Interview Questions PDF By ScholarHat
PDF
Estimating the Total Costs of Your Cloud Analytics Platform
PDF
Acunu Whitepaper v1
PPTX
An Overview of VIEW
PDF
Top 9 Proven Practices: To Enhance Data Solutions with Databricks
PPTX
No sql database
PDF
Snowflake Architecture Explained – Layers, Components & Benefits | Brolly Aca...
PDF
Big Data Engineering for Machine Learning
PDF
Enterprise Data Lake
PDF
Enterprise Data Lake - Scalable Digital
iovlabs.pdf
What Is a Data Lakehouse? Benefits, Features & Platforms
Snowflake Technology.docx
Things You Should Know About Snowflake Warehouses
Introduction to Snowflake & Cloud Data Warehousing | Best Snowflake Online Tr...
SnowPro Core Study Guide for certification.pdf
Data Engineering Interview Questions & Answers Warehouses & Lakehouses (Snowf...
Snowflake Training in Hyderabad Snowflake Training - Enroll Now.pptx
Snowflake_Cheat_Sheet_Snowflake_Cheat_Sheet
Why Snowflake is important and what is Snowflake
Azure Data Factory Interview Questions PDF By ScholarHat
Estimating the Total Costs of Your Cloud Analytics Platform
Acunu Whitepaper v1
An Overview of VIEW
Top 9 Proven Practices: To Enhance Data Solutions with Databricks
No sql database
Snowflake Architecture Explained – Layers, Components & Benefits | Brolly Aca...
Big Data Engineering for Machine Learning
Enterprise Data Lake
Enterprise Data Lake - Scalable Digital
Ad

More from VishnuGone (20)

PDF
Ansible Copy Module.pdf
PDF
Salesforce Lightning Design System.pdf
PDF
Snowflake Time Travel.pdf
PDF
Ansible vs Kubernetes.pdf
PDF
windows vs linux.pdf
PDF
Linux Operating System.pdf
PDF
Linux Bash.pdf
PDF
Alteryx Vs Knime.pdf
PDF
Pega RuleSet.pdf
PDF
What is Apigee.pdf
PDF
MuleSoft Anypoint Platform.pdf
PDF
Alteryx Tools.pdf
PDF
SailPoint VS CyberArk.pdf
PDF
What is Apigee.pdf
PDF
Alteryx Tutorial Step by Step Guide for Beginners
PDF
Pega Tutorial.pdf
PDF
Sailpoint vs Okta.pdf
PDF
Differences Between Power BI vs SSRS
PDF
Power BI Data Modeling.pdf
PDF
Power BI Dashboard.pdf
Ansible Copy Module.pdf
Salesforce Lightning Design System.pdf
Snowflake Time Travel.pdf
Ansible vs Kubernetes.pdf
windows vs linux.pdf
Linux Operating System.pdf
Linux Bash.pdf
Alteryx Vs Knime.pdf
Pega RuleSet.pdf
What is Apigee.pdf
MuleSoft Anypoint Platform.pdf
Alteryx Tools.pdf
SailPoint VS CyberArk.pdf
What is Apigee.pdf
Alteryx Tutorial Step by Step Guide for Beginners
Pega Tutorial.pdf
Sailpoint vs Okta.pdf
Differences Between Power BI vs SSRS
Power BI Data Modeling.pdf
Power BI Dashboard.pdf
Ad

Recently uploaded (20)

PDF
LIFE & LIVING TRILOGY - PART - (2) THE PURPOSE OF LIFE.pdf
PDF
International_Financial_Reporting_Standa.pdf
PDF
Complications of Minimal Access-Surgery.pdf
PDF
1.3 FINAL REVISED K-10 PE and Health CG 2023 Grades 4-10 (1).pdf
PDF
LIFE & LIVING TRILOGY - PART (3) REALITY & MYSTERY.pdf
PPTX
B.Sc. DS Unit 2 Software Engineering.pptx
PDF
Journal of Dental Science - UDMY (2020).pdf
PPTX
Computer Architecture Input Output Memory.pptx
PDF
AI-driven educational solutions for real-life interventions in the Philippine...
PDF
English Textual Question & Ans (12th Class).pdf
PDF
IP : I ; Unit I : Preformulation Studies
PDF
Hazard Identification & Risk Assessment .pdf
PDF
CISA (Certified Information Systems Auditor) Domain-Wise Summary.pdf
PDF
Journal of Dental Science - UDMY (2021).pdf
PDF
BP 505 T. PHARMACEUTICAL JURISPRUDENCE (UNIT 2).pdf
PPTX
Unit 4 Computer Architecture Multicore Processor.pptx
PDF
Race Reva University – Shaping Future Leaders in Artificial Intelligence
PDF
LIFE & LIVING TRILOGY- PART (1) WHO ARE WE.pdf
PDF
Myanmar Dental Journal, The Journal of the Myanmar Dental Association (2013).pdf
PDF
Empowerment Technology for Senior High School Guide
LIFE & LIVING TRILOGY - PART - (2) THE PURPOSE OF LIFE.pdf
International_Financial_Reporting_Standa.pdf
Complications of Minimal Access-Surgery.pdf
1.3 FINAL REVISED K-10 PE and Health CG 2023 Grades 4-10 (1).pdf
LIFE & LIVING TRILOGY - PART (3) REALITY & MYSTERY.pdf
B.Sc. DS Unit 2 Software Engineering.pptx
Journal of Dental Science - UDMY (2020).pdf
Computer Architecture Input Output Memory.pptx
AI-driven educational solutions for real-life interventions in the Philippine...
English Textual Question & Ans (12th Class).pdf
IP : I ; Unit I : Preformulation Studies
Hazard Identification & Risk Assessment .pdf
CISA (Certified Information Systems Auditor) Domain-Wise Summary.pdf
Journal of Dental Science - UDMY (2021).pdf
BP 505 T. PHARMACEUTICAL JURISPRUDENCE (UNIT 2).pdf
Unit 4 Computer Architecture Multicore Processor.pptx
Race Reva University – Shaping Future Leaders in Artificial Intelligence
LIFE & LIVING TRILOGY- PART (1) WHO ARE WE.pdf
Myanmar Dental Journal, The Journal of the Myanmar Dental Association (2013).pdf
Empowerment Technology for Senior High School Guide

Snowflake Cloning.pdf

  • 1. A Comprehensive Guide to Snowflake Cloning In the ever-evolving landscape of data management, databases play a crucial role in storing and organizing vast amounts of information. With the increasing complexity and scale of modern applications, having a flexible and efficient database structure is essential for smooth operations. One such innovative approach that has gained traction in recent years is snowflake cloning, a technique that enables organizations to optimize their database performance by creating virtual copies or snapshots of specific tables within a larger database. Traditionally, when it comes to analyzing large datasets or running complex queries, developers often face challenges due to the immense processing power required. Copying an entire database or table for analysis purposes can be time-consuming and resource-intensive. This is where snowflake cloning steps in as a game-changer. What is Snowflake? Snowflake is a cloud-based data warehousing platform that provides a fully managed and scalable solution for storing, analyzing, and processing large amounts of structured and semi-structured data. It is designed to handle data-intensive workloads and offers features such as high concurrency, automatic scaling, and native support for SQL queries. Snowflake's architecture separates storage and compute, allowing organizations to scale their compute resources independently based on their needs. It is known for its ease of use, performance, and the ability to handle complex data analytics tasks. Become a Snowflake Certified professional by learning this HKR Snowflake Training ! Database Cloning: Database cloning refers to the process of creating an exact replica or copy of a database. This copy contains the same data and structure as the original database but exists independently. Cloning a database is typically done for various purposes such as testing, development, reporting, analysis, or creating backups. Snowflake Clones and its uses: In the context of Snowflake, "clones" refer to an advanced feature of the Snowflake data warehousing platform. Snowflake allows users to create clones of their databases or specific tables within a database. A clone is a lightweight, efficient, and virtually instantaneous copy of the original database or table. Snowflake clones are useful for several reasons: a. Testing and Development: Clones provide a safe and isolated environment for testing new code, making changes, and experimenting without affecting the production data. Developers can create clones to test queries, perform data transformations, or develop new features. Want to know more about Snowflake,visit here Snowflake Tutorial !
  • 2. b. Performance Optimization: Clones can be used to improve the performance of resource-intensive workloads. By creating clones, different teams or users can work independently without impacting each other's performance. It allows for parallel processing and enables efficient resource allocation. c. Data Analysis: Clones are beneficial for performing data analysis and running complex queries without affecting the production database. Analysts can create clones to explore the data, generate insights, and create reports without impacting the live system. d. Cost Control: Snowflake's cloning feature is built on its unique architecture, where storage and compute are decoupled. Clones utilize the same underlying storage as the original database but consume compute resources independently. This allows organizations to optimize costs by scaling compute resources for specific tasks without duplicating storage. Top 30 frequently asked Snowflake Interview Questions ! Conclusion: In conclusion, snowflake cloning is a powerful feature in Snowflake's database that allows for efficient and cost-effective data replication. By creating a clone of a table or an entire database, users can easily make changes or perform analysis without affecting the original data. The ability to clone tables also enables parallel processing, speeding up queries and improving overall performance. Additionally, with the flexibility to create clones on-demand, organizations can quickly scale their data operations as needed. As businesses continue to generate and analyze large volumes of data, snowflake cloning offers a valuable solution for managing and manipulating data efficiently. Embracing this feature will undoubtedly enhance productivity and drive better insights for organizations of all sizes. So why wait? Start leveraging snowflake cloning in your data operations today! If you want to know more about snowflake cloning, visit this blog Snowflake Cloning !